Clear-Com bets on InfoComm 2023 with new IP intercom systems
The Arcadia central station and improvements in the role-based workflow of its Eclipse HX digital matrix focus the proposal that Clear-Com will show in Orlando (Florida - EU).
The manufacturer Clear-Com will participate in the edition 2023 of InfoComm in Orlando to show, of the 14 al 16 June (booth 3854) its latest advances in IP based intercom for a wide variety of corporate and live event applications, theaters, rent, etc.
The Arcadia central station Clear-Com IP-based technology will be available for demonstrations to attendees. Added to this are the new features of its flagship Eclipse HX Digital Matrix Intercom System, including real-time production software Dynam-EC, role-based workflows and a touch screen panel desktop.
As already mentioned Digital AV during Clear-Com's participation in WHEREAS 2023, Arcadia is a scalable IP intercom platform that brings together HelixNet, FreeSpeak, Encore, others 2W/4W endpoints and devices Dante from third parties in a single integrated system.
One of the advantages of Arcadia is that its license-based scalability, which allows us to respond to numerous production needs, with support for more than one hundred beltpacks and even 128 IP port.
For applications requiring up to two hundred FreeSpeak and peer-to-peer workflows, Eclipse HX digital matrix provides a range of exclusive tools to deliver power and efficiency.
One of these is Dynam-EC, powerful software that allows the operator to control the status of all Clear-Com audio inputs and outputs; audio mapping; the IFBs and the partylines.
